Appendix: Shortcut Keys

3DS Max has many many shortcut keys. Here is an incomplete list of the common ones that you will find useful.

Transformations

Key

What it does

w

turns on move (translation) manipulator

e

turns on rotation manipulator

r

turns on scale manipulator

x

turns big colourful manipulators on and off

Camera Changes (applied to current viewport)

Key

What it does

p

changes to perspective camera

t

changes to orthographic top camera

b

changes to orthographic bottom camera

l

changes to orthographic left camera

f

changes to orthographic front camera

z

zooms to current selection or extents

Viewport Related Toggles (applied to current viewport)

Key

What it does

F3

toggles display of faces (solid vs mesh only)

F4

toggles display of edges

F2

toggles face highlighting

alt-w

toggles between multi viewport and single maximized viewport

g

toggles grid
